During our meeting, you expressed several ideas that will help me run the [x] project. WebbSo, if you want to calculate a semi-monthly daily rate, divide your employee’s annual salary by 260. Semi-Monthly Hourly Rate = Annual Salary / 2,080. There are 52 weeks in a year and 40 hours in a regular workweek, which means 2,080 hours worked per year. To figure out a semi-monthly employee’s hourly wage, divide their salary by 2,080.

Typically, an employee must stay with a company for a year or pay back the bonus if ... Webb27 sep. 2024 · 4.2.2 Earning Vacation. Employees accrue 15 days of vacation for the first year of employment and 20 days of vacation each year after the first year. This works out to a monthly accrual of 1.25 vacation days during the first year and 1.6667 vacation days per month after the first year. Part time employees accrue vacation on a pro-rated basis.
